No-code platforms enable rapid deployment with visual builders and pre-built components, ideal for MVPs, simple workflows, and quick time-to-market solutions where customization needs are limited. Custom development delivers tailored software with full control over architecture, scalability, and integration—essential for enterprise applications, complex business logic, competitive differentiation, and long-term growth.

Choose no-code if: You need fast prototyping, have budget constraints, require standard features, and plan limited customization. Platforms like Zapier, Bubble, and Airtable excel here.

Choose custom development if: You demand unique functionality, require enterprise-grade security, need seamless API integrations, plan significant scale, or compete on product innovation. Custom solutions grow with your business and protect intellectual property.

No-code platforms are ideal for rapid prototyping, MVPs, and applications with straightforward workflows that fit within platform constraints. Choose no-code when speed to market, budget constraints, and limited customization needs are priorities. However, if your application requires unique logic, deep integrations, scalability for thousands of users, or specialized security requirements, custom development delivers the flexibility and control needed for long-term growth.
No-code solutions typically have lower upfront costs and faster deployment, making them budget-friendly for MVPs and small projects. Custom development requires higher initial investment but eliminates ongoing platform licensing fees and vendor lock-in, offering better long-term cost efficiency for enterprise-scale applications. No-code platforms have inherent scalability limits tied to their infrastructure and feature sets, making them suitable for small to medium workloads. As user numbers, data volume, and complexity increase, custom development provides unlimited scalability, performance optimization, and the ability to handle enterprise demands. Migrating from no-code to custom later is costly and time-consuming, so PerfectionGeeks recommends custom development if long-term growth and scale are anticipated.
No-code platforms create vendor dependency—your application lives within their ecosystem, limiting your ability to switch platforms or customize beyond their constraints. Custom development ensures full ownership of your codebase, technology stack, and intellectual property, giving you complete control and flexibility. For businesses planning multi-year or long-term operations, custom development reduces risk and provides strategic independence.
